According to the British Wind Energy Association (BWEA), which has 499 members in the wind and tidal energy industries, the wind industry in the UK will produce more power than the nuclear industry in the next decade.

Maria McCaffery, CEO of the BWEA, said “Wind will overtake nuclear in term of installed capacity within the next four to five years”. By 2015, 9 Gigawatts will be installed offshore. This should allow the wind industry to provide electricity to every UK home by 2020.

The BWEA reported that the only danger for wind industry results from the lack of competition at manufacturers level. Three to four competitors will lead to bring down construction costs, which are expected to rise for the next few years and then decline from current levels until 2015. Today’s construction prices are about £3.1 million per Megawatt of installed capacity.
